WebMar 22, 2011 · Copy. Elevator Counterweight = Half of Elevator Maximum Capacity + Cab Weight. For eg: 10passenger Elevator = 10*80 = 800Kgs. Counter Weight is 800/2 = 400Kgs + Cab Weight. This is just to create a imbalance between Elevator cab and counterweight in order to save power in the drive. Wiki User. WebApr 21, 2024 · Typical stair lifts have a weight capacity of 300 pounds, though many have capacities of 350 to 400 pounds. Stair lifts are designed with various safety protocols in place to ensure the safe transportation of the user. However, beyond weight, there are other considerations, like arm width and seat belt functionality that should be assessed.
